I get whacked in the street for playing Fair City bad boy Ciaran

Actor ‘hit with handbags’ over kidnap

- BY KEELEY RYAN news@irishmirro­r.ie

FAIR City star Johnny Ward has been getting “whacked across the head with handbags” for playing kidnapper Ciaran Holloway. The Dubliner has been part of one of the longest running and most talked about storylines in the history of the hit RTE soap. And as things look set to come to a head this week, Johnny admitted he feels lucky to have taken on the dark role – even with the backlash. He said: “I’ve been blessed, I really have. Right at the start, they told me all this top secret informatio­n that I had to keep from the rest of the cast. “I couldn’t say anything to anyone. No one else in the cast knew. It’s been tough, but it’s been a blast.” The Carrigstow­n mechanic took drastic action kidnapping Katy as he wanted to get revenge on her brother Emmet for breaking his sister Tessa’s heart after a holiday romance. And it looks like the star played his villainous part convincing­ly. Johnny joked: “I’m getting women whacking me across the head with handbags!” Despite the mixed reaction to his character, Johnny admitted it will be difficult when his time in Carrigstow­n comes to an end. He told TV Now Magazine: “I don’t know how it’s going to end for Ciaran. “I can’t see him sitting in Mccoy’s in two weeks’ time or in two years’ time, reminiscin­g with Eoghan about kidnapping Katy. “When it does come eventually to an end, I’m really going to miss it.”
